Wow! In one little thread two contradictory assertions:

"Alternative browsers such as Firefox and Opera do not appear to be vulnerable to the attack." »www.vnunet.com/vnunet/news/21868···-attacks

"Mozilla Firefox uses the same underlying Windows code for processing ANI files, and can be exploited similarly to Internet Explorer" »www.derkeiler.com/Mailing-Lists/···536.html

Since Firefox most assuredly calls upon the Windows API, I will err on the side of caution.

This flaw is a Windows's flaw, not a browser's flaw. Both browsers IE and Firefox are at risk:

Determina also discovered that under certain circumstances Mozilla Firefox uses the same underlying Windows code for processing ANI files, and can be exploited similarly to Internet Explorer

All applications that use certain Windows API calls are affected, including Internet Explorer, Windows Explorer, Mozilla Firefox and Outlook.
